#264656 Hex Color Code

#264656

The Hexadecimal Color #264656 is a contrast shade of Dark Slate Gray. #264656 RGB value is rgb(38, 70, 86). RGB Color Model of #264656 consists of 14% red, 27% green and 33% blue. HSL color Mode of #264656 has 200°(degrees) Hue, 39% Saturation and 24% Lightness. #264656 color has an wavelength of 494.07407n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#264656 is #336666.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#264656 is #245. The Closest Color to #264656 is #2F4F4F. Official Name of #264656 Hex Code is Blue Dianne.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#264656 is 56 Cyan 19 Magenta 0 Yellow 66 Black and #264656 CMY is 56, 19, 0. HSLA (Hue Saturation Lightness Alpha) of #264656 is hsl(200,39,24, 1.0) and HSV is hsv(200, 56, 34). A Three-Dimensional XYZ value of #264656 is 4.67, 5.46, 9.61.
Hex8 Value of #264656 is #264656FF. Decimal Value of #264656 is 2508374 and Octal Value of #264656 is 11443126. Binary Value of #264656 is 100110, 1000110, 1010110 and Android of #264656 is 4280698454 / 0xff264656. The Horseshoe Shaped Chromaticity Diagram xyY of #264656 is 0.236, 0.277, 0.277 and YIQ Color Space of #264656 is 62.256, -24.2096, -1.7888. The Color Space LMS (Long Medium Short) of #264656 is 4.21, 6.04, 9.54. CieLAB (L*a*b*) of #264656 is 28.01, -6.55, -13.17. CieLUV : LCHuv (L*, u*, v*) of #264656 is 28.01, -13.1, -15.48. The cylindrical version of CieLUV is known as CieLCH : LCHab of #264656 is 28.01, 14.71, 243.56. Hunter Lab variable of #264656 is 23.37, -5.22, -8.03.

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#264656

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
